We want to use VConsol for all virtual hearings; else what happened in Karnataka could occur: Kerala High Court

The judge made the remark while he was sitting as part of a division bench with Justice Shoba Annamma Eapen earlier today.

The bench was hearing appeals preferred by the Kerala Infrastructure Investment Fund Board (KIIFB) and former State Finance Minister Dr. Thomas Isaac, challenging an order of a single-judge permitting the Enforcement Directorate (ED) to issue fresh summons to them in connection with a probe into KIIFB’s financial transactions.

During the hearing, standing counsel for ED, advocate Jaishankar V Nair informed the bench that the delay on the part of Additional Solicitor General ARL Sundaresan from joining the virtual hearing was due to the fact that lawyers have to first register and have an account on VConsol Court to access the virtual hearing.

This prompted Justice Mustaque to remark that even though lawyers have to register, VConsol offers better protection in terms of cyber security.
